summaryrefslogtreecommitdiffstats
path: root/drivers/s390/block/scm_blk.c (follow)
Commit message (Expand)AuthorAgeFilesLines
* block: move the add_random flag to queue_limitsChristoph Hellwig2024-06-191-4/+0
* block: move the nonrot flag to queue_limitsChristoph Hellwig2024-06-191-1/+0
* s390/scm: use new address translation helpersHeiko Carstens2024-03-131-3/+3
* scm_blk: pass queue_limits to blk_mq_alloc_diskChristoph Hellwig2024-02-201-8/+9
* block: pass a queue_limits argument to blk_mq_alloc_diskChristoph Hellwig2024-02-131-1/+1
* s390/scm: fix virtual vs physical address confusionVineeth Vijayan2023-12-081-3/+4
* s390/mm: make virt_to_pfn() a static inlineLinus Walleij2023-08-161-1/+1
* block: remove blk_cleanup_diskChristoph Hellwig2022-06-281-2/+2
* block: remove genhd.hChristoph Hellwig2022-02-021-1/+0
* s390/block/scm_blk: add error handling support for add_disk()Luis Chamberlain2021-10-041-1/+6
* scm_blk: use blk_mq_alloc_disk and blk_cleanup_diskChristoph Hellwig2021-06-111-15/+6
* blk-mq: move failure injection out of blk_mq_complete_requestChristoph Hellwig2020-06-241-1/+2
* block: genhd: add 'groups' argument to device_add_diskHannes Reinecke2018-09-281-1/+1
* s390/scm_blk: correct numa_node in scm_blk_dev_setupVasily Gorbik2018-07-021-0/+1
* block: Use blk_queue_flag_*() in drivers instead of queue_flag_*()Bart Van Assche2018-03-081-2/+2
* s390: block: add SPDX identifiers to the remaining filesGreg Kroah-Hartman2017-11-241-0/+1
* s390/scm_blk: consistently use blk_status_t as error typeSebastian Ott2017-09-191-3/+3
* s390/scm: use common completion pathSebastian Ott2017-08-091-5/+8
* s390: fix up for "blk-mq: switch ->queue_rq return value to blk_status_t"Stephen Rothwell2017-07-051-5/+5
* Merge branch 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/s39...Linus Torvalds2017-07-041-144/+118
|\
| * s390/scm: use multiple queuesSebastian Ott2017-06-121-11/+41
| * s390/scm: convert taskletSebastian Ott2017-06-121-39/+15
| * s390/scm: convert to blk-mqSebastian Ott2017-06-121-65/+72
| * s390/scm: remove cluster optionSebastian Ott2017-06-121-42/+3
* | block: introduce new block status code typeChristoph Hellwig2017-06-091-4/+4
|/
* scm_blk: remove unneeded REQ_TYPE_FS checkChristoph Hellwig2017-01-311-7/+0
* block: convert to device_add_disk()Dan Williams2016-06-271-2/+1
* s390/scm_blk: fix deadlock for requests != REQ_TYPE_FSSebastian Ott2016-04-011-1/+1
* s390/scm_block: make the number of reqs per HW req configurableSebastian Ott2014-12-081-15/+33
* s390/scm_block: handle multiple requests in one HW requestSebastian Ott2014-12-081-46/+99
* s390/scm_block: allocate aidaw pages only when necessarySebastian Ott2014-12-081-4/+28
* s390/scm_block: use mempool to manage aidaw requestsSebastian Ott2014-12-081-7/+38
* block: disable entropy contributions for nonrot devicesMike Snitzer2014-10-041-0/+1
* block: Convert bio_for_each_segment() to bvec_iterKent Overstreet2013-11-241-4/+4
* s390/scm_block: do not hide eadm subchannel dependencySebastian Ott2013-11-151-18/+6
* s390/scm_blk: fix endless loop for requests != REQ_TYPE_FSSteffen Maier2013-11-061-1/+5
* block_device_operations->release() should return voidAl Viro2013-05-071-2/+1
* s390/scm_blk: fix memleak in init functionSebastian Ott2013-04-261-2/+1
* s390/scm_blk: fix error return code in scm_blk_init()Wei Yongjun2013-03-211-2/+5
* s390/scm_block: fix printk format stringSebastian Ott2013-03-211-2/+2
* s390/scm_blk: suspend writesSebastian Ott2013-03-071-5/+56
* s390/scm_blk: fix request number accountingSebastian Ott2013-03-071-2/+6
* s390/scm_block: force cluster writesSebastian Ott2012-09-261-3/+34
* s390: add scm block driverSebastian Ott2012-09-261-0/+414